A Study to Identify and Characterize LAL-D Patients in High-risk Populations
A Study to Identify the Frequency of Lysosomal Acid Lipase Deficiency in At-Risk Patient Populations

Summary
The objective of this study is to determine the frequency of Lysosomal Acid Lipase Deficiency (LAL D) by lysosomal acid lipase (LAL) enzyme activity assay in patients who are considered to be at risk.
